The game's idea is basic, which is why it's so easy to get hooked on. You see a lovely stack of tiles organized in a complicated way. There are classic Chinese characters, bamboo, circles, or seasonal symbols on each tile. What do you do? Tap on two free squares that match to get rid of them. Sounds simple. But things become complicated quickly when there are layers and blocked tiles that hide other tiles.
